Xavier is a salesperson who is paid a fixed amount of $455 per week. He also earns a commission of 3% on the sales he makes. If Xavier wants to earn more than $575 in one week, how many dollars (x) in sales must he make? x > 1,060 x > 4,000 x < 3,600 x < 1,060

    575 - 455 = $120 (amount of commissions he'll have to earn.

    To make $120 in commissions, his sales would have to be $120/.03 =

    $4,000.00
